Republic Europe Offers Retail Entry to Kraken IPO

Republic Europe has launched a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V) to enable European retail investors indirect equity exposure to Kraken, a leading crypto exchange, prior to its anticipated IPO. This presents a significant opportunity in the crypto sector.

Kraken, founded in 2011, is known for its robust user base, with over 13 million users globally. The move by Republic Europe could allow retail investors to benefit from Kraken’s forthcoming public offering.

Retail Demand Drives SPV for High-Profile Tech Firms

The SPV targets a growing demand for inclusive investment opportunities in high-profile tech firms. However, Kraken has not yet confirmed participation or provided additional details on its IPO schedule.

The arrangement may encourage interest from retail investors seeking entry into private markets, potentially increasing competition for returns in emerging tech and crypto-related IPOs.

Past Ventures Highlight Indirect Investment Appeal

There are limited precedents for such arrangements in the crypto sector. Republic Europe’s previous ventures, like offering exposure to ByteDance, indicate growing interest in indirect investment vehicles.

Experts suggest this could lead to broader market participation. Historical trends in tech IPOs demonstrate potential for significant returns, particularly for early equity exposure. Republic Europe’s move may stimulate more such offerings.
